Michigan iGaming
The Michigan Gaming Control Board is the state body charged with ensuring fair and honest gaming in the interests of Michigan residents.

Besides licensing and regulating Detroit's commercial casinos, it licenses and regulates online gaming and sports betting operators, platform providers and suppliers, regulates pari-mutuel horse racing and casino-style charitable gaming, and audits compliance with tribal gaming compacts. It also publishes market figures: commercial and tribal operators reported a combined 341.3 million dollars in internet gaming and online sports betting gross receipts for June 2026.
